5 The GCOS Second Report on the Adequacy of the Global Observing System - April 2003 Authors: GCOS, in collaboration with the Global Terrestrial Observing System (GTOS), the World Weather Watch (WWW) with its Global Observing System (GOS) and the Global Atmosphere Watch (GAW). Scope: international, regional, national and individual activities to be coordonated internationally Aim of the report: report on the adequacy of the global observing systems for climate; establishing the scientific requirements for systematic climate observations. The goals of this Report were to determine what progress has been made in implementing climate observing networks and systems since the first report; determine the degree to which these networks meet with scientific requirements and conform with associated observing principles; and assess how well these current systems, together with new and emerging methods of observation, will meet the needs of the UNFCCC. Annex lists key climate variables and describes systems (available and potential)

7 CEOS response to GCOS implementation ”CEOS identifies what can be achieved by better coordination of existing and future capabilities as well as those improvements that require additional resources and/or mandates beyond the present capacity of space agencies. This report is intended to initiate action and assist the Parties in advising and commenting on the planning actions within the agencies.” Specifically respond to actions in the implementation plan. For example Action O-2: Relevant CEOS space agencies will consult with the science community on appropriate retrieval algorithms of passive microwave observation for reprocessing sea ice products …………. 14 Socioeconomic Data The Theme intends to create a framework for improved coordination of cryospheric observations conducted by research, long-term scientific monitoring, and operational programmes, and to generate the data and information needed for both operational services and research. ICSU report on socioeconomic data. Greater coordination and analysis are needed to aggregate, link, and grid socioeconomic data collected at the local or national level to larger scales, including global datasets. IGOS should improve its access to information about socioeconomic data in relevant Themes. This should take place with the appointment of individuals who are knowledgeable about socioeconomic data to specific Theme Teams.
